Home Page
Articoli
Tips & Tricks
News
Forum
Archivio Forum
Blogs
Sondaggi
Rss
Video
Utenti
Chi Siamo
Contattaci
Username:
Password:
Login
Registrati ora!
Recupera Password
Home Page
Stanze Forum
SQL Server 2000/2005/2008, Express, Access, MySQL, Oracle
Inserte sulle date non corretto
lunedì 02 febbraio 2009 - 14.56
Elenco Threads
Stanze Forum
Aggiungi ai Preferiti
Cerca nel forum
Cyberking
Profilo
| Junior Member
79
messaggi | Data Invio:
lun 2 feb 2009 - 14:56
Ciao a tutti, in una tabella anagrafica sul mio db online, ho il campo di data di nascita che è di tipo datetime
Da un pò di giorni mi sta succedendo una cosa strana, ovvero vado a fare l'inserimento dei dati dalla pagina jsp e la data che mi ritrpovo dentro è sbagliata, ma solo nell'anno.
Esempio, se inserisco una data di nascita tipo 09/03/1975 mi ritrovo nel db il valore a 09/03/2019, cosa può essere successo?
Pensando che arrivassero male i dati dal form, sto provando a scrivere direttamente il valore "09/03/1975", ma non cambia nulla
http://www.gurutour.it
Jeremy
Profilo
| Guru
1.527
messaggi | Data Invio:
lun 2 feb 2009 - 15:07
Secondo me, dovresti innanzitutto verificare se 'fisicamente', nella tabella del Db, il valore viene memorizzato correttamente(fondamentale per capire se il problema è nel deposito o nel prelievo del dato).
Dopo...a seconda del risultato che ottieni da questa verifica,dovresti mostrare il codice con cui depositi o prelevi il dato dal Db.
Facci sapere...
Ciao
alx_81
Profilo
| Guru
8.814
messaggi | Data Invio:
lun 2 feb 2009 - 15:10
>Ciao a tutti,
Ciao!
>in una tabella anagrafica sul mio db online, ho
>il campo di data di nascita che è di tipo datetime
>Da un pò di giorni mi sta succedendo una cosa strana, ovvero
>vado a fare l'inserimento dei dati dalla pagina jsp e la data
>che mi ritrpovo dentro è sbagliata, ma solo nell'anno.
>Esempio, se inserisco una data di nascita tipo 09/03/1975 mi
>ritrovo nel db il valore a 09/03/2019, cosa può essere successo?
Bisognerebbe vedere la procedura o il modulo che usi per inserire il valore.
Comunque sia, prova ad inserirla in ISO (19750309) e vedi cosa succede.
Se inserisce male anche quello c'è qualcosa che non va nella tua procedura.
Usi sql server vero?
--
Alessandro Alpi | SQL Server MVP
http://www.alessandroalpi.net
http://blogs.dotnethell.it/suxstellino
http://mvp.support.microsoft.com/profile/Alessandro.Alpi
http://italy.mvps.org
Cyberking
Profilo
| Junior Member
79
messaggi | Data Invio:
mar 3 feb 2009 - 10:00
il problema è sicuramente nell'inserimento, aprendo proprio la tabella mi ritrovo il dato 08/02/2019
http://www.gurutour.it
Cyberking
Profilo
| Junior Member
79
messaggi | Data Invio:
mar 3 feb 2009 - 10:01
ok, ora provo, ma devo cambiare qualche cosa nel db o posso provare a fare l'insert (dalla pagina jsp) direttamente con il dato tipo 19750309
grazie
http://www.gurutour.it
alx_81
Profilo
| Guru
8.814
messaggi | Data Invio:
mar 3 feb 2009 - 16:00
>ok, ora provo, ma devo cambiare qualche cosa nel db o posso provare
>a fare l'insert (dalla pagina jsp) direttamente con il dato tipo
>19750309
prova a farlo diretta dalla jsp, e ricordati le apici, è una stringa non un intero.
--
Alessandro Alpi | SQL Server MVP
http://www.alessandroalpi.net
http://blogs.dotnethell.it/suxstellino
http://mvp.support.microsoft.com/profile/Alessandro.Alpi
http://italy.mvps.org
Torna su
Stanze Forum
Elenco Threads
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?
Dopo esserti registrato potrai chiedere
aiuto sul nostro
Forum
oppure aiutare gli altri
Consulta le
Stanze
disponibili.
Registrati ora !